Abstract enMar¯asid al-Ittıl¯a‘, written by Saf¯ı al-D¯ın Abd al-Mu’min al-Baghd¯ad¯ı, is a geographic dictionary. It is formed in an encyclopedic style and introduces Islamic geography. Records and informations on the location names in the book are very important for Medieval Turkish history. In addition, including the places of non-residential areas makes it a more valuable work. Although Mar¯asid al-Ittıl¯a‘ is a concise of Mu’jam al-Buld¯an written by Y¯akut al-Hamaw¯ı, still it must be considered as a indispensible source for especially in historical and literatural researches on Anatolian geography. By introducing mountains, seas, rivers, lakes residental areas, it contrutes to the studies on historical geography. In this work, it is intended to analyze the records of Mar¯asid al-Ittıl¯a‘ especially on Istanbul, Konya and many other of Anatolian cities and geographic places
